formal 是什么意思

中文释义
a. 正式的, 形式的, 礼仪的, 拘于礼节的, 拘谨的
n. 正式的社交活动
英文释义
a. being in accord with established forms and conventions and requirements (as e.g. of formal dress)
s. characteristic of or befitting a person in authority
a. (of spoken and written language) adhering to traditional standards of correctness and without casual, contracted, and colloquial forms
s. logically deductive
